Certification-company Intertek has also joined the Xpansiv Digital Fuels Program ecosystem as DCO-certification partner, adding another source of data-quality assurance, carbon-intensity benchmarking, and independent certifications.
Xpansiv created the Digital Fuels Program to support the creation, issuance, registration, management, trading, and retirement of encrypted digital twins that include the environmental attributes of fuels. The program includes a burgeoning network of energy producers, data refineries, monitoring networks, lifecycle assessments, standards and certification organizations, and downstream market participants—all operating under a Governance Framework that specifies data quality and management protocols, as well as full lifecycle requirements for these new digital assets.
Similar to DNGs, DCOs bring transparency and precision to measuring the ESG impacts of crude-oil production based on immutable data, auditable from source to market.

In September, Xpansiv announced the first transaction of Digital Natural Gas® (DNG™) through its DF Registry. Since then, more than 2,000 Methane Performance Certificates (MPCs) have traded, with daily price assessments provided by S&P Global Platts. DNG empowers downstream customers to demonstrate quantified progress in meeting methane-reduction commitments and net-zero goals based on empirical data. Producers are uploading approximately 1 billion cubic feet of natural gas data onto the Xpansiv platform every day to create DNG.
